Kwithu Women’s Group is a community-based, non-profit organization committed to improving the quality of life for women, youth, children, and other vulnerable populations in Luwinga Ward, on the outskirts of Mzuzu City. Our mission is to feed, educate, and empower communities through holistic, sustainable, and community-led development. Currently, Kwithu supports over 1,185 direct beneficiaries across five integrated program areas that address both immediate needs and long-term resilience: • Feeding Program: Provides nutritious meals three times a week to 566 children and elderly beneficiaries, improving school attendance, concentration, and overall health. • Education Program: Supports 434 vulnerable learners from early childhood through tertiary education with scholarships, academic support, and mentorship. • Women and Youth Empowerment: Reaches over 483 participants through business training, revolving loans, and leadership development initiatives. • Vocational Skills Training: Equips 60 out-of-school youth annually with practical skills in trades such as carpentry, tailoring, bricklaying, and food production. • HIV/AIDS and Community Outreach: Promotes health and wellbeing through awareness campaigns, nutrition support, and home-based care, reaching the broader community and all program participants. Kwithu’s holistic approach strengthens resilience, promotes equity, and drives sustainable community transformation by creating opportunities at every stage of life.
